Confucius said: Those who make Mingqi know the way of funeral, and they prepare things but cannot use them. Alas! The dead are used with the utensils of the living. Isn't it dangerous to use them as sacrifices? Mingqi means to show the gods. Painting carts with straw spirits has existed since ancient times, and it is the way of Mingqi. Confucius said that those who make straw spirits are good, and those who make figurines are unkind - isn't it dangerous to use people!

The people of Wei believed that turtles were knowledgeable. Chen Ziche died in Wei. His wife and her family's senior officials planned to bury him alive with her. After the plan was finalized, Chen Zikang arrived and told her, "My master is ill and there is no one to take care of him. Please bury him alive with me." Zikang said, "Burying him alive with me is not a courtesy. Even if I do, who should take care of him like my wife and the prime minister? If I have to, I will do it. If I have to, I will let my two sons do it." So he did not do it.
